What is Trenbolone?
Trenbolone is a synthetic anabolic steroid derived from nandrolone. Originally developed for veterinary use to increase muscle mass in livestock, it has gained immense popularity in the fitness world due to its remarkable effectiveness.

How Trenbolone Works
Trenbolone works by binding to androgen receptors in muscle tissues, which enhances protein synthesis and promotes a favorable environment for muscle growth. It also increases nitrogen retention, resulting in an anabolic environment that is conducive to muscle development.
Risks and Considerations
While Trenbolone offers numerous benefits, it is not without risks. Potential side effects include:
- Insomnia and night sweats
- Increased aggression
- Potential cardiovascular issues
- Suppression of natural testosterone production
Due to these potential risks, it is crucial to approach the use of Trenbolone with caution and to consider consulting a healthcare professional before starting a cycle.
